Will Prime Minister Narendra Modi Step Down in September? Devendra Fadnavis Denies Retirement Rumors
As the political discourse surrounding Prime Minister Narendra Modi's future continues to intensify, speculation regarding his potential retirement in September has sparked a major debate. However, Maharashtra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is swiftly dismissed these claims, asserting that Modi will remain the leader of the ruling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) for the foreseeable future.The rumors of Modi's retirement began circulating after Shiv Sena leader Sanjay Raut suggested that the Prime Minister might step down upon turning 75 in September, citing an unwritten rule within the ruling party that leaders over that age cannot hold ministerial posts.
